Micrometer Calibration

A micrometer could seem basic-- simply screw and gauge-- yet temperature level changes and put on can present little mistakes. During calibration, specialists make use of scale obstructs with recognized dimensions to confirm accuracy throughout the device's range, making certain measurements to the micron remain trustworthy.

The Calibration Process: Step by Step

Planning and Documentation-- Define the scope, tools and appropriate tolerances. Initial Inspection-- Check physical condition, tidy and no devices. Recommendation Comparison-- Use traceable criteria to compare analyses. Change-- Fine-tune the tool to meet specifications. Confirmation-- Re-test and make sure analyses are within tolerance. Qualification and Reporting-- Issue a certificate outlining techniques, unpredictability and days.

Role of Certification Bodies

Approved labs adhere to stringent width procedures. They preserve traceability chains back to national institutes, adjusting instruments like torque wrenches or micrometers against key standards. Picking the Right Calibration Partner

Not all calibration services are produced equal. Right here are a couple of things to remember when selecting a companion:

    Accreditation: Look for NCSL or ISO/IEC 17025 approval. Traceability: Ensure requirements map back to national institutes. Turnaround: Balance speed with thoroughness-- rushed calibrations can miss drift. Reporting: Clear certificates with uncertainty values and valid dates.
